Transaction 26434bb6b11386bdf0cd06f144b6790e5f33a200d9dc5f4ed41bb74cbbb76b54
1 Input
1 Output
-
26434bb6b11386bdf0cd06f144b6790e5f33a200d9dc5f4ed41bb74cbbb76b54:0
- value
- 1429521
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1e4b651d9e38f8a369647782fac590b4158819ea201a1075f986f606c3d3886a
- address
- bc1pre9k28v78ru2x6tyw7p043vsks2csx02yqdpqa0esmmqds7n3p4qvzgf5h